Forth Ports raises 2006 expectations

The United Kingdom’s Forth Ports has raised its full-year expectations after increased property profits and port volumes.

   Forth Ports operates seven ports in Scotland, mainly in the Forth Estuary, and the Port of Tilbury on the Thames in England.

   At Tilbury, Forth Ports said it has experienced increased cargo volume from the Far East, stronger bulk tonnages and rising short-sea container volumes. The company also said its Scottish ports will see an improvement in financial performance in the second half of the year over the first half.
